The Public Self #
When the Midheaven in Libra occupies the ninth house, the professional identity is shaped by broad thinking and cultural sophistication. Others recognize this person as someone who bridges perspectives — a diplomat of ideas who connects different worldviews, educational traditions, or cultural frameworks with elegance and fairness. Their reputation positions them as the person you consult when complex intellectual territory needs to be navigated with both rigor and grace, when different philosophical camps need a translator between them.
How the Sign Shapes Approach #
Libra on the MC channels the career through partnership, aesthetics, and justice. The professional instinct is collaborative and refined. This person prefers work environments where intellectual exchange is valued, where differences are debated rather than shouted, and where the final product demonstrates proportion and balance. They avoid intellectual brutality, favoring persuasion through reason and beauty. Their arguments are structured to include rather than exclude, presenting multiple perspectives before offering synthesis.
The House Context #
The ninth house governs higher education, philosophy, publishing, long-distance travel, and cross-cultural engagement. With the MC here, career success comes through expansive thinking — the person thrives in academia, international relations, publishing, law, or religious and philosophical institutions. Professional growth requires exposure to perspectives far beyond their origin culture. Travel, advanced study, or immersion in foreign traditions often catalyzes career breakthroughs. The broader their intellectual exposure, the more effective their professional contributions become.
Professional Strengths #
This combination produces excellent professors, international mediators, publishers, comparative philosophers, or cultural diplomats. They can present complex ideas accessibly and fairly, making them effective teachers and writers who audiences trust precisely because the presentation feels balanced. Their Libran sense of proportion prevents intellectual dogmatism — they present multiple sides before offering conclusions. In legal or academic settings, their fairness earns trust across ideological divides, making them effective department chairs, journal editors, or diplomats working between cultures.
Growth Considerations #
The risk is intellectual fence-sitting disguised as open-mindedness. The ninth house invites grand conclusions and bold stances, but Libra resists commitment to a single position. Over time, the person may become so skilled at presenting all viewpoints that their own perspective becomes invisible, and their work may lack the conviction that moves fields forward. Growth comes from allowing the accumulated breadth of their learning to crystallize into clear, publicly stated positions — even at the cost of not pleasing every intellectual camp simultaneously.
